Juan‐Hua Chen is a scholar working on Molecular Biology, Plant Science and Biochemistry. According to data from OpenAlex, Juan‐Hua Chen has authored 12 papers receiving a total of 701 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 5 papers in Plant Science and 3 papers in Biochemistry. Recurrent topics in Juan‐Hua Chen's work include Photosynthetic Processes and Mechanisms (4 papers), Lipid metabolism and biosynthesis (3 papers) and Mitochondrial Function and Pathology (2 papers). Juan‐Hua Chen is often cited by papers focused on Photosynthetic Processes and Mechanisms (4 papers), Lipid metabolism and biosynthesis (3 papers) and Mitochondrial Function and Pathology (2 papers). Juan‐Hua Chen collaborates with scholars based in China, Sweden and Czechia. Juan‐Hua Chen's co-authors include Fang‐Qing Guo, Qinglong Wang, Si‐Ting Chen, Yao Zhao, Sha Yu, Jiawei Wang, Karin Ljung, Karel Doležal, Tian‐Qi Zhang and Hongbo Tang and has published in prestigious journals such as PLoS ONE, The Plant Cell and The Plant Journal.
